Much as I love the Pilot bracelet on my Headwind, I like to have options, and lately have been considering buying a leather strap as well. As the lug width is 22mm, I'd need a 22-20, or a 22-18 strap, and this is where things get complicated. I'd normally go for a 22-20 strap w/ tang buckle, but I've seen a used deployant clasp that I might get for a good price. (These puppies retail at 180 Euros when new ![]() The problem is that it's intended for 20-18 size straps. Do you think it would still fit a 22-18 strap? Do these 18mm clasps come in different sizes for different lug width at all? I'll attach a pic, the seller claims it's 100% original, but if you think otherwise, don't hesitate to say so! There were 22/18s and 20/18s. a 18mm clasp will fit both however xx/18 straps are no longer made as far as I know. BN thanks for your comment in the other place. |
